Cinnamon Bark, Cinnamon Sticks or Cinnamon Quills are made from the dried inner bark of Cinnamomum verum. The tree is coppiced and the new shoots harvested every year. The outer Cinnamon bark is stripped off to reveal a thin inner bark that curls naturally into a quill as it dries.
Cinnamon Sticks are also useful for steeping in milk for custards and sauces and for preparing a poaching liquid. You don't actually eat the sticks!
These sticks are about 7cm long.
